Migraine and white matter lesions: a mendelian randomization study
Junyan Huo1, Gan Zhang1, Wenjing Wang1
1Department of Neurology, Peking University Third Hospital, No. 49, North Garden Rd., Haidian District, Beijing, 100191, China.
Scientific Reports
|July 6, 2023
Summary
This study investigated the causal link between white matter lesions (WMLs) and migraine using Mendelian randomization. Findings indicate no significant bidirectional causal relationship between WMLs and migraine.
Area of Science:
- Neurology
- Genetics
- Epidemiology
Background:
- Migraine is frequently associated with white matter lesions (WMLs).
- The etiological relationship between migraine and WMLs remains unclear.
- Understanding this relationship is crucial for clinical management and research.
Purpose of the Study:
- To investigate the bidirectional causal relationship between migraine and WMLs.
- To determine if WMLs increase migraine risk or if migraine increases WML risk.
- To leverage large-scale genetic data for robust causal inference.
Main Methods:
- Utilized a two-sample Mendelian randomization (MR) approach.
- Employed summary-level data from large genome-wide association studies (GWAS).
- Analyzed three white matter phenotypes (WMH, FA, MD) and migraine, applying inverse variance-weighted (IVW), weighted median, simple median, and MR-Egger regression methods.
Main Results:
- No evidence of a causal effect of WMLs on migraine was found across all applied MR methods.
- No evidence of a causal effect of migraine on WMLs was found.
- The bidirectional MR analysis did not support a causal link in either direction.
Conclusions:
- The study provides no support for a causal relationship between white matter lesions and migraine.
- Migraine does not appear to increase the risk of developing WMLs.
- WMLs do not appear to cause or increase the risk of migraine.
